Biographical entry Hearn, William Edward (1826 - 1888)

The Hon. Dr, Professor

Born
21 April 1826
Belturbet, County Cavan, Ireland
Died
23 April 1888
Melbourne, Victoria, Australia
Occupation
Jurist, Political Economist, Politician and University teacher
Summary

QC, AM, LLD Dub.
University of Melbourne, Chancellor from 3 May to 4 October 1886.
University of Melbourne, Warden of the Senate from 8 August 1686 to 24 August 1875.
University of Melbourne, President of the Professorial Board from 1856 to 1857.
University of Melbourne, first Professor of Modern History and Literature from 1854 to 1855.
University of Melbourne, Professor of Classics from 1855 to 1856, and 1871 to 1873.
University of Melbourne, Dean of the Faculty of Law from 1873 to 23 April 1888.
